Overview
One block from Charlottesville's downtown, in a brick building full of studios, McGuffey Art Center has been run by its own artists since 1975. It calls itself one of the oldest artist cooperatives in the country, and the arrangement is unusual enough to be worth stating plainly: the people who make the work also run the place. Roughly 45 artists rent studios inside the building, and more than 100 belong to the wider association that keeps it going. Walk in on an open afternoon and you can often see the work being made, not just hung.
The center sits at 201 2nd St NW, Charlottesville, VA 22902, close enough to the pedestrian mall that it folds naturally into a downtown walk. A cooperative structure means the artists themselves carry the load — teaching, exhibiting, organizing events, and doing community outreach — rather than handing those jobs to an outside staff. That is the thing to understand before you visit. This is a working building, not a static gallery.
What you'll find inside
McGuffey runs several exhibition spaces under one roof. The Sarah B. Smith Gallery hosts featured solo and small-group shows, while the first- and second-floor galleries carry larger rotating exhibitions, including the center's all-member summer show, which pulls work from across the resident and associate rosters. In a recent season that meant a solo exhibition of felt and fiber work by Lindsay Heider Diamond in the Sarah B. Smith Gallery, shown alongside a member summer show spanning encaustic, painting, and more across the two floors. The mix shifts through the year, so the walls rarely look the same twice.
Beyond the galleries, the building is a warren of individual studios. Because the artists are in residence rather than merely represented, the place has the texture of a workplace — the smell of a medium being used, a door open onto a project in progress, the particular quiet of people concentrating. If you like art most when you can sense the hand behind it, McGuffey rewards the visit.
Classes, membership, and getting involved
Part of what the cooperative does is teach. Resident and associate artists offer classes and workshops through the center, so McGuffey functions as a place to learn a medium as much as to look at one. The specific slate changes with who is teaching and what season it is, so it is worth checking the current listings before you plan around a class.
The center also invites the public in through its membership and support programs, including a "Friend of McGuffey" option for people who want to back the place without renting a studio or joining as a working artist. It is a straightforward way to keep a decades-old cooperative solvent, and it reflects the same self-supporting spirit that has kept the doors open this long.
Hours and planning your visit
McGuffey is open Tuesday through Sunday and closed Mondays. Tuesday through Thursday and Saturday it runs 10 AM to 6 PM; Friday it stays open late until 8 PM, which makes it an easy stop on a downtown evening; and Sunday it keeps shorter afternoon hours, 1 to 5 PM. Because exhibitions rotate and artist talks and openings land on their own schedule, calling ahead or checking the website is the safe move if you are coming for something specific.
